Wild Weekend at Motorama: Trucks mounted on tanks, hot rods galore and much more at beloved Toronto motor show

Toronto, Ontario — Hundreds of auto enthusiasts cascaded upon Toronto’s International Centre this weekend for the Motorama Custom Car and Motorsports Expo’s first event in two years.

The event filled more than 25,000 square metres (25,000 sq.-ft.) of the venue with 400+ vehicles on display and booths from 150+ exhibitors.

Vehicles showcased included custom cars, hot rods, classics, trucks, exotics, tuners, rat rods and racing vehicles of all kinds.

SATA Canada, BASF, NAPA Auto Parts and eBay Motors were just a few companies in attendance, in addition to dozens of car clubs from across Ontario and beyond.

Celebrity guests included “Bad Customs” TV stars Bad Chad Hiltz and ‘Queen’ Jolene; the guys from DeBoss Garage, who brought a pickup truck mounted on a tank, and Dave Schroeder of Schroeder Ens Racing, who brought both his winning Corvettes to the venue.
